One Aadhaar Number, Stricter Rules — Big Shift Ahead!

    Share on

The Aadhaar system is undergoing a significant overhaul in 2025. Key among the changes is the policy that each person may now only hold one valid Aadhaar number: if multiple numbers exist for the same individual, the earliest-issued with biometric data will be retained while the rest are cancelled.

The document-list for enrolment and updates has been revised: individuals aged 5 or older now must submit updated Proof of Identity (PoI), Proof of Address (PoA), Proof of Date of Birth (DoB) and Proof of Relationship (PoR) from the specified list. For example, for children under 5 now there are defined paths—either Head-of-Family based enrolment or institution-based certificates. The process of enrolment and update also incorporates cross-database verification with PAN, driving licence, MGNREGS records and electricity bills to reduce fake or duplicate Aadhaar numbers. 
Another major change: private-sector entities (in e-commerce, hospitality, health, fintech) are now formally authorised under the Aadhaar (Targeted Delivery of Financial and Other Subsidies, Benefits and Services) Act, 2016 to carry out Aadhaar authentication under the new “Authentication for Good Governance (Social Welfare, Innovation, Knowledge) Rules, 2025”.

These changes aim to strengthen identity integrity, reduce fraud and broaden the ecosystem of Aadhaar-based services. All Aadhaar-holders and service-providers should review the new rules carefully to ensure compliance and smooth transition.
